Adjusting the Viewfinder to Your Eyesight

Adjust the viewfinder to suit your eyesight. If it is difficult to see the viewfinder image clearly, slide the diopter adjustment lever sideways. You can slide the diopter from -2.5 m-1 to +1.5 m-1.

1.Aim the AF point over the subject, and then press the shutter button halfway.

2.Adjust the diopter adjustment lever to suit

your eyesight.

-Viewfinder is adjusted to your eyesight.

Diopter adjustment lever

AF Frame

The eyecup is attached to the viewfinder portion when camera leaves the factory. Diopter adjustment is available with the eyecup attached. However, adjustment is easier with the eyecup removed as shown above. To remove the eyecup, pull upward and remove as shown on the right.

Using the Zoom ring

Using the zoom ring, you can enlarge (telephoto angle) or reduce (wide angle) the size of an image by changing the focal length value of the camera lens. Adjust it to the desired size and take the picture.

1.Position the subject in focus.

2.Turn the zoom ring to the right or left.

-Turn the zoom ring clockwise for telephoto and counterclockwise for wide angle.

Look through the viewfinder to compose your picture at the focal

length that looks right for your purpose. Turn the zoom ring right or left until you see the composition you want.

A fixed focal length lens do not includes the zoom ring.
